Jennifer Lawrence stuns in Dior, will eat to stay calm for upcoming Oscar awards (Photos)

Jennifer Lawrence, 22, who first rose to fame with her role in “The Hunger Games” has launched her first ad campaign for Dior in sophisticated black-and-white portraits.

Lawrence has previously admitted that she feels like a “fat” actress by Hollywood standards. However the photos that were taken by Willy Vanderperre for Dior show her as anything but fat.

The actress may decide to walk the red carpet in Dior as she has done previously. It was at the Oscars luncheon recently when she joked around about how she keeps calm before the Oscars.

"Eating normally calms me down," Lawrence said. "I remember before the 2011 Oscars I was wearing that skintight dress and I ate a Philly cheese steak and fries and was like, 'This is definitely going to help,' which it didn't because I had to double my Spanx.”

She is a front-runner for winning an Oscar this Sunday considering she has already received a Golden Globe award and Screen Actors Guild award for her role as a neurotic widow in "Silver Linings Playbook.”

It was in 2011 when she was nominated for an Oscar for her role in “Winter’s Bone” however lost.

"It's really exciting but it never sinks in. I am so in the zone when I am working that when you hear it, you are like 'Wow'. I know what an honor that is," Lawrence said. "I am not going to cry myself to sleep if it doesn't happen. I'm still going to be happy, I'm still going to be me, I'm still going to have my friends and I will be fine," she added.
